Studio 99 Inc

2525 15th St Unit 1D
Denver, CO 80211

Studio 99 Inc is a Denver-based company that emphasizes creativity and innovation in its offerings. With a commitment to excellence, they ensure that all rights are reserved for their unique creations.

Dedicated to maintaining privacy and integrity, Studio 99 Inc prioritizes the protection of its intellectual property. Their focus on quality and originality sets them apart in the competitive landscape of creative services.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esColoradoDenverStudio 99 Inc

Partial Data by Infogroup (c) 2025. All rights reserved.